Come On Down, You're the Next Contestant On...

Ludia, a Montreal interactive entertainment company, announced the release of the The Price is Right. The game includes real sounds, videos, theme songs, and the voice of the TV announcer of The Price is Right.

The game allows the player to compete as they try to bet on prizes on Contestant row, beat one of the 16 true to show games, spin the big wheel and bet on showcases in the showcase showdown.

Adding to the casual game theme, players can play by themselves or with friends and win achievements for their trophy room.

The game is incredibly close to the real show. “Our team has worked tirelessly to create an authentic, easy-to-play game that gives players access to ‘The Price Is Right’ stage on their home computers.” said Ludia’s founder and CEO, Alex Thabet. “This first Ludia game release sets the high standard that we intend to maintain for each of our upcoming titles.”

Ludia will continue producing games based on TV shows such as FOX's Hell's Kitchen, which will be the next game released by the company. The game promises to have recipes from the show, two gaming modes (Arcade and Career) and a Lifelike 3D model of Gordon Ramsay to rate your performance.
